noun
the lowest temperature that is theoretically possible, at which the motion of particles which constitutes heat would be minimal. It is zero on the Kelvin scale, equivalent to −273.15°C.

Mass, weight does not equal size. An object the size of the sun with only the mass of our moon would never achieve fusion and would float in water.
